Smart Climate Sensors
Smart climate sensing units have transformed the effectiveness of modern watering systems by changing watering timetables based upon real-time environmental data. These sensors keep an eye on variables such as temperature, humidity, wind rate, and solar radiation, enabling systems to react dynamically to transforming weather. By incorporating this information, wise sensing units can enhance water usage, reducing waste and ensuring that landscapes obtain the proper quantity of moisture. This technology not just conserves water yet also advertises healthier plant growth by protecting against overwatering or underwatering. Soil Wetness Sensors
Dirt moisture sensing units play a crucial function in modern-day watering systems, giving real-time data that improves water performance. These devices determine the volumetric water material in the dirt, enabling accurate evaluations of dampness degrees. By integrating soil moisture sensors right into watering systems, individuals can prevent overwatering or underwatering, ultimately advertising healthier plant development and conserving water resources.The sensing units send information to controllers, which can readjust sprinkling timetables based on current soil problems. This data-driven method decreases water waste and warranties that plants receive the most effective amount of wetness.
